Adalat CC (nifedipine) is an extended-release formulation of nifedipine, a dihydropyridine calcium channel blocker. In animal studies, nifedipine has been associated with embryotoxicity, fetotoxicity, and teratogenicity (e.g., digital anomalies, cleft palate) at doses several times the maximum recommended human dose. In humans, data are limited but there is no clear evidence of a significant increase in major congenital malformations. First trimester exposure is not strongly associated with major defects; however, some studies suggest a possible small increase in oral clefts. Second and third trimester use may cause maternal hypotension and subsequent fetal distress (e.g., reduced uteroplacental perfusion). Use near term may theoretically inhibit labor, but nifedipine is used as a tocolytic for preterm labor. Overall, the risk is considered low; however, fetal monitoring is recommended if used in pregnancy. FDA Pregnancy Category C (prior to 2015 categorization).

Nifedipine is excreted into human breast milk in small amounts. The milk-to-plasma (M/P) ratio is approximately 0.56 to 1.0 based on limited data. The estimated daily infant dose via milk is less than 5% of the maternal weight-adjusted dose, which is considered clinically insignificant. No adverse effects have been reported in breastfed infants. However, caution is advised, especially with high maternal doses or prolonged use. The American Academy of Pediatrics considers nifedipine compatible with breastfeeding.

Pregnancy may alter the pharmacokinetics of nifedipine due to increased plasma volume and altered hepatic metabolism. However, specific dosing adjustments for Adalat CC in pregnancy are not well established. In clinical practice, dosing for hypertension in pregnancy (e.g., preeclampsia) often uses immediate-release nifedipine, not extended-release. For Adalat CC, the same dosing as in non-pregnant adults (30-90 mg once daily) is typically used, but titration should be cautious to avoid maternal hypotension. No formal dose adjustment is recommended, but careful monitoring and individualized titration are advised.

Adalat CC (nifedipine extended-release) is a dihydropyridine calcium channel blocker used primarily for hypertension. Avoid in patients with unstable angina or within 4 weeks of myocardial infarction due to reflex tachycardia risk. May cause peripheral edema, especially in higher doses; consider adding an ACE inhibitor if edema is problematic. CYP3A4 inhibitors (e.g., grapefruit juice, macrolides, azole antifungals) significantly increase nifedipine levels; avoid coadministration. Tablet shell may appear intact in stool; this is normal.
